I'm inching closer to sending out resumes, filling out applications, etc. My goal is to be in NE Asia (I'm focusing on Japan and Korea) by early May, or thereabouts. This sounds like a reasonable time frame, based on what I've been reading here. Something interesting landed in my lap this afternoon, though. I was asked to consider a 9-week work assignment in Costa Rica. If it were to eventuate, then I'd aim to be in J or K sometime in July. Although the schools advertise themselves as hiring year-round, I wonder: is there a definite better or worse time for applications? Would a July ETA harm my chances of finding a decent position? Thoughts, anyone? The Costa Rica thing is only a possibility at this stage, and I'd like to have as much information as possible before making my decisions.

It depends- Public schools hire for March and September ( mostly March though) and hagwons, where most ESLers work, really do hire year round. Most schools would probably want you to start at the begining of the month though, so getting here mid month puts you in a good position to find work.

yes, but usually they hire during jan/feb for march and july/august for september. look at the boards now, there are more and more public school jobs every day.
